Abstract

Purpose

The purpose of this paper is to develop a decision support system (DSS) for multi grade fuzzy leanness assessment (MGFLA) (DSS‐MGFLA).

Design/methodology/approach

The assessment of leanness gains vital importance. Due to the drawbacks associated with conventional approaches, fuzzy methods are gaining importance. In this context, multi‐grade fuzzy method has been used for leanness assessment. Since the computation is time consuming and error‐prone, a computerized DSS known as DSS‐MGFLA has been developed.

Findings

DSS‐MGFLA enables the accurate evaluation of leanness. Besides assessing leanness, DSS also enables the identification of improvement areas. The DSS has been validated in an Indian relays manufacturing organization. Based on the validation, its practical feasibility has been ensured.

Research limitations/implications

DSS‐MGFLA has been validated in a single manufacturing organization for its working feasibility. But the findings could be extended to similar manufacturing organizations.

Originality/value

The idea of developing DSS for leanness assessment is novel, original and unique contribution of authors.
